Sculpture Milwaukee installing artwork around downtown

MILWAUKEE (CBS 58) – Wisconsin Avenue in downtown Milwaukee is starting to fill up with huge sculptures. Crews were busy installing one on Wednesday as part of Sculpture Milwaukee.

The free outdoor urban art experience first came to Milwaukee last year. Wednesday’s sculpture is made of black and white concrete and weighs 18,000 pounds.

“It’s an interesting structure where the base, the bottom half is integral to the top half. In fact, the bottom half was the mold for the top half,” said sculptor Mel Kendrick.

More than 20 sculptures will be placed along Wisconsin Avenue from 6th Street to O’Donnell Park. They will all be unveiled in June.
